BORN-WITH-IT BACK PAIN
Some of us are born with spinal weaknesses that will
be with us forever. Such conditions as spondylolisthesis, transitional vertebrae, fused vertebrae, and spinal curvatures are unique to one's
own spine. There is no way to "get a new back bone"
if one of these conditions is ours. So we must learn how to respect our spines so as to not trigger
pain. Your Baton Rouge chiropractor at Spine & Sports Rehab Center can perform
the spinal manipulation intended to alleviate
your specific spinal condition. Then, you will want to think
about its
- proper ergonomic use (how to lift, bend, twist, sit,
stand, walk, climb, reach, pull, etc.). You don't want to compromise your now-pain-relieved
spine further or again.
- nutritional needs - Spine & Sports Rehab Center will suggest
some nutrition ideas to bolster
certain weaknesses of the spine.
- strengthening prerequisites - Our simple exercises don't take long but will
take you and your spine far in preserving its strength!
It is in these continued spine problems that
we - you and your Baton Rouge chiropractor - must
partner for the greatest
outcome, even coming in for occasional spinal manipulation. (1)
LIFE-ACQUIRED BACK PAIN
Some of us injure our backs. We do
things that damage the seemingly healthiest
of spines: falling off a snowmobile or ladder or wakeboard or
lifting excess weight. You get the idea - things
we do in everyday activities of daily living may harm
us, and we wind up with back pain. So, when we damage the spine to the
level that we cause intervertebral disc degeneration, a herniated disc, arthritis, misaligned vertebrae, etc., we now will contend
with a spinal weakness which may become the weak link
in our spinal health.
We all must nurture a strong,
well-aligned spine and utilize the spine with the respect and knowledge of
dodging those activities
that could cause it pain.

PATIENT-CENTERED BACK PAIN CARE: CHIROPRACTIC
A new report reflected on the
reality of low back pain being a major cause of disability globally. It is persistent or recurrent for many people. It is
not known to just go away and
never return. Luckily, chiropractic maintenance care or
management treatment plan has been reported as
effective in reducing painful days for some
sufferers. Patients for whom maintenance care was recorded to be
of high value described such care as “patient-centered” while
cost, (un)availability of care, and fear of treatment concerned
